1. 方案目标
- 提高测试效率:通过AI自动化生成测试用例、执行测试、分析结果,减少人工干预。
- 增强测试覆盖率:利用AI分析代码、需求、历史数据,发现更多潜在缺陷。
- 降低测试成本:减少人工测试工作量,优化测试资源分配。
- 智能缺陷预测:基于历史数据预测高风险模块,提前预防缺陷。
2. 方案架构图
+-----------------------+
| 测试管理平台 |
| (Test Management) |
+-----------+-----------+|v
+-----------------------+
| AI测试引擎 |
| (AI Test Engine) |
+-----------+-----------+|v
+-----------------------+
| 数据层 |
| (Data Layer) |
| - 测试用例库 |
| - 缺陷数据库 |
| - 代码库 |
| - 日志数据 |
+-----------------------+|v
+-----------------------+
| 执行层